Q: Is 945,832 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 945,832 is not a prime number.

Why is 945,832 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 945832 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 191 382 619 764 1,238 1,528 2,476 4,952 118,229 236,458 472,916 and 945,832, with no remainder.

Since 945,832 cannot be divided by just 1 and 945,832, it is not a prime number.
